I was taught by a Protestant pastor (when I was a Protestant) the SAME THING that I am being taught by the Orthodox Christian church: that LDS has (1) a different god, (2) a different savior, (3) a different pathway to salvation, and lastly, (4) a different heaven.

I've studied it. It's true: their "god" is predated by the Universe, he was a being that perfected himself, their "Christ" is merely the "firstborn" and not as John 1:1 describes, their path to salvation involves earning it through individual effort, and lastly, they have three heavens.

Mormonism can't bear close scrutiny without falling apart. Not if one approaches it with intellectual integrity, it can't.
